Specifications

Core Configuration

Radeon HD 5730GeForce GTS 450
GPU NameRedwood (Redwood XT)vsGF106 (GF106-250-KA-A1)
Fab Process40 nmvs40 nm
Die Size104 mm²vs238 mm²
Transistors627 millionvs1,170 million
Shaders400vs192
Compute Units5vs4
Core clock775 MHzvs783 MHz
ROPs8vs16
TMUs20vs32

Memory Configuration

Radeon HD 5730GeForce GTS 450
Memory TypeGDDR5vsGDDR5
Bus Width128 bitvs128 bit
Memory Speed1000 MHz
4000 MHz effective
vs902 MHz
3608 MHz effective
Memory Size1024 Mbvs1024 Mb

Additional details

Radeon HD 5730GeForce GTS 450
TDP64 wattsvs106 watts
Release Date26 Feb 2011vs13 Sep 2010
